Planning a train journey from Newcastle to Bexleyheath? The trip usually takes about 4hrs 42 mins, covering approximately 253 miles (407 kilometres). With roughly 28 trains operating daily, you have plenty of options to suit your schedule. Booking your tickets ahead of time can snag you fares as low as £42.40, offering an economical choice for savvy travelers.

Newcastle Train Station is well-equipped to make your travel experience as smooth as possible. The ticket office opens as early as 6 AM on weekdays, providing ample time for travelers to plan ahead. Alternatively, convenient ticket machines are scattered throughout the station, and they cater well to those with accessibility needs. For comfort, the station offers waiting rooms and seating areas, both of which are open throughout the operating hours. If you require any assistance, staff are on hand from the early hours until midnight.
The station is accessibility friendly with step-free access available to several platforms, assisted by both lifts and ramps when necessary. Do note, however, that while the station is widely accessible, some platforms accessed via steep bridges may require assistance. The luxurious 1st Class Lounge offers an elevated waiting experience and is a delightful option for premium ticket holders.
For those wanting to grab a bite or do some last-minute shopping, Newcastle Train Station doesn't disappoint. Choose from familiar names such as Costa Coffee, Greggs, and Sainsbury's among others. Whether you fancy a quick snack, a hearty meal, or simply a cup of coffee, the station has something to satisfy your appetite. Additionally, ATM machines are conveniently placed, with one located near the Boots store on the main concourse.
Getting in and out of Newcastle is a breeze, thanks to the extensive transport options available at the station. Taxis are available 24/7, and rail replacement services conveniently depart from the station's front. The local Tyne & Wear Metro system provides seamless connections to the Newcastle airport and beyond, easily accessible from adjacent platforms. For more information on bus schedules and routes, the station offers printable guides, ensuring you're well-equipped for onward travel.

Bexleyheath Station is well-equipped with facilities designed for a smooth and accessible travel experience. Ticket purchasing is straightforward with a ticket office open from Monday to Saturday until 20:00 and slightly reduced hours on Sunday. For those collecting tickets bought online, accessible machines are available in the station forecourt. The station embraces modern ticketing with smartcards issued and validated here.
The station boasts full step-free access, making it easy for those with mobility needs to navigate. Although there are 83 parking spaces available, including four accessible ones, bear in mind that parking equipment here isn't fully adapted for accessibility needs. While the station lacks luggage storage and accessible toilets, other conveniences like payphones, a coffee kiosk, and a newspaper stand are present. Secure storage for 32 bicycles is available, though hiring services are not a facility at this station. Remember, CCTV offers peace of mind in various areas, ensuring safety during your visit.
For onward travel, Bexleyheath Station efficiently connects you with local bus services and rail replacement options. If a journey toward Lewisham or Dartford is in your plans, make use of bus stops BF and BH respectively on Pickford Lane. Planning ahead is simplified with further information available in printable formats online, allowing you to coordinate public transport options smoothly.
